World No. 7 @ThiemDomi becomes 1st player since himself to win a set from Rafael Nadal on clay, taking 1st set of #MMOpen QF 7-5. Nadal's consecutive sets streak ends at 30 overall and 50 on clay. His last set and match lost on clay was to Thiem in 2017 @InteBNLdItalia QF.

With @ThiemDomi's upset of Rafael Nadal at #MMOpen, @RogerFederer will return to No. 1 in #ATP Rankings on 14 May for 5th stint and 309th week. Nadal would reclaim World No. 1 on 21 May if he wins his 8th @InteBNLdItalia title.
